The Ruisseau de la Réverotte is a productive small watercourse in the Jura department of Bourgogne-Franche-Comté, offering diverse fishing opportunities for carp, catfish, zander, pike, bream, and perch throughout its 8km stretch. Anglers will appreciate the flexibility of night fishing and the ability to bivouac along the banks, making extended fishing trips feasible in this scenic regional setting. A Carte de Pêche (annual fishing licence obtainable through the local AAPPMA) is required to fish this waterway, which also permits recreational boating activities.

To fish Ruisseau de la Réverotte, you need a valid Carte de Pêche, available from cartedepeche.fr before you leave the UK and affiliation with the local AAPPMA covering this stretch. Annual, weekly and daily licences are all available online.
